Output dda32cfa8f177f1fb6ba4063bdfda2f283c70cf7f73ac800f907ab94b797b4d7:186

value
13614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f943478a4b2113f51e0ec9d22276c6fa7e71a248 OP_EQUAL
address
3QQzmy6QSZJjkG6XGZAgX83N4qboo1nRjo
transaction
dda32cfa8f177f1fb6ba4063bdfda2f283c70cf7f73ac800f907ab94b797b4d7
confirmations
490781
spent
true